CFL in regular contact with the family of the deceased and two other victims after the tragic ferris wheel accident

CFL General Manager Charles Taylor

Communications Fiji Limited states that CFL is in regular contact with the family of the deceased and the two other victims recovering in hospital after the tragic ferris wheel accident at Fiji Showcase 2023 last Friday.

CFL General Manager, Charles Taylor says they remain on standby to assist when and where required.

Taylor also says apart from the merry-go-round, all other mechanical amusement rides at Fiji Showcase have been suspended while they await police instructions for their removal from the venue after the tragic accident.

He says CFL also acknowledges and thanks the Minister for Employment, Productivity and Industrial Relations Agni Deo Singh and his Ministry for its report.

Taylor says as stated, a National OHS team on behalf of the amusement ride operators conducted and passed all rides prior to the event and a certificate was received.

He says CFL will continue to assist the ministry and police with ongoing investigations.

Taylor confirms that the mechanical rides will be replaced with bouncy castles.
